Hbase Shell如何搭建Docker测试环境以及常用命令是什么
发表于:2025-01-31 作者:千家信息网编辑
千家信息网最后更新 2025年01月31日,这篇文章给大家介绍Hbase Shell如何搭建Docker测试环境以及常用命令是什么,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。测试环境安装与配置: docker se
千家信息网最后更新 2025年01月31日Hbase Shell如何搭建Docker测试环境以及常用命令是什么
这篇文章给大家介绍Hbase Shell如何搭建Docker测试环境以及常用命令是什么,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。
测试环境安装与配置: docker search hbase # pull 稳定版 docker pull harisekhon/hbase:1.3 docker run -d -h app.hbase.com -p 2181:2181 -p 8080:8080 -p 8085:8085 -p 9090:9090 -p 9095:9095 -p 16020:16020 -p 16301:16301 -p 16000:16000 -p 16010:16010 -p 16201:16201 -p 16030:16030 -v /Users/val/Documents/my/hbase/data:/hbase-data --name hbase harisekhon/hbase:1.3 -h app.hbase.com 是域名,可以在 /etc/hosts 配置 * 注意,-h 不能用localhost,会有问题,java程序连不上 # 查看 web admin http://app.hbase.com:16010/master-status http://app.hbase.com:16030/rs-status # 进入客户端 hbase shell
Hbase Shell管理命令 # 查看存在哪些表 list # 创建表 create '表名称','列名称1','列名称2','列名称N' # 删除表: 先屏蔽表,再drop disable '表名称' drop '表名称' # 查看删除帮助 help delete # 查看服务器状态 status # 查看版本 version # 获得表的描述 describe '表名称' # 添加列族 alter '表名称', 'Family' # 删除列族 alter '表名称', {NAME => 'Family', METHOD => 'delete'} # 启用/禁用表 is_enabled '表名称' is_disabled '表名称' # 检查表是否存在 exists '表名称' Hbase Shell 增删改查 # 添加/覆盖记录 put '表名称','RowKey','Family:Qualifier','值' put 't_product', '321', 'p:width', 5.3 # hbase是强类型,这里是放入了一个小数 put 't_product', '321', 'p:width', '5.3' # hbase是强类型,这里是放入了一个字符串 # 根据rowKey查看记录 get '表名称','RowKey' get '表名称','RowKey','Family' # 查看表记录 scan '表名称' scan '表名称', {COLUMN=>'Family'} scan '表名称', {COLUMN=>'Family:Qualifier'} # 限制条数/版本数/开始行查看 scan '表名称', { STARTROW => 'RowKey', LIMIT=>1, VERSIONS=>1} # 复杂条件过滤 scan '表名称', { FILTER=>"ValueFilter(=,'Qualifier:QualifierValue')" } # 列值包含 scan '表名称', { FILTER=>"ColumnPrefixFilter('QualifierValue')" } # 列名前缀 scan '表名称', { FILTER=>"ColumnPrefixFilter('QualifierValue') AND ValueFilter ValueFilter(=,'Qualifier:QualifierValue')" } # AND / OR 构建复杂过滤 scan '表名称', { FILTER=>"PrefixFilter('RowKey')" } # RowKey前缀 # 查看表某个列记录 scan '表名称','Family:Qualifier' # 查看表记录数 count '表名称' # 根据rowKey、family、qualifier删除记录 delete '表名称','RowKey','Family:Qualifier' # 删除整行 deleteall '表名称', 'RowKey'
关于Hbase Shell如何搭建Docker测试环境以及常用命令是什么就分享到这里了,希望以上内容可以对大家有一定的帮助,可以学到更多知识。如果觉得文章不错,可以把它分享出去让更多的人看到。
名称
命令
环境
测试
帮助
常用
复杂
内容
前缀
更多
版本
类型
配置
不错
兴趣
域名
字符
字符串
客户
客户端
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
洞窝软件开发
pdms数据库打开
魔兽玩家服务器排队
魔兽世界服务器 罗宁
网络技术对地理学研究的影响
网络安全法视频免费下载
信息网络安全泄密的危害
自己建立服务器需要多少钱
网络安全宣传卡片内容
App软件开发及时性
江苏泰州特殊服务器
怎么查看数据库配置
远程管理服务器密码
完善公安机关网络安全机制
数据库开发技术文档
宣城软件开发公司电话
上单男枪是哪个服务器先玩
怎么用向导创建数据库
将该数据库升级为最新版本
二调数据库标注表达式
服务器支持带外管理接口
软件开发工作目的
常用的解决网络安全的技术
数据库sql创建登录名
东城电脑服务器回收机构
发信邮件服务器不规范
网络安全主要表现及特征
华为服务器命令管理接口
简单的ftp服务器
茂业软件开发